Loitam’s report ready to roll

Richard Loitam, a second semester student of the Acharya NRV School of Architecture at Soladevanahalli in Bangalore North, was found dead on April 18 morning at his hostel room.

The Madanayakanahalli police on Monday briefed a police official from Manipur about the progress of investigation into the death of Manipuri student Richard Loitam at a city college hostel.

Following widespread protests, the Manipur government had deployed superintendent of police Potsangbam Dhanakumar to assess the speed of investigation and also check whether the attack was a racist one, or whether other Manipuri students in the city too were facing similar problems.

Dhanakumar met Bangalore Rural superintendent of police D Prakash and discussed the investigations into the case. He also met forensic experts at Victoria Hospital and doctors who had conducted the postmortem.

The Manipur police official also visited the college and hostel, along with the local police. “Dhanakumar questioned many students, especially eye witnesses of the fight that took place between the deceased, Vishal Banerji and Syed Afzal Ali. He recorded their statements about the incident. He is also awaiting the pathology report,” a police officer said.

After this, he will be submitting a detailed report to Manipur Government.
